 <description>&lt;p&gt;As a mediator, I so frequently see what happens between the company and the employee when management does not adequately clarify its expectations.  Everyone feels betrayed, frustrated and angry, and the resources and energy expended to resolve the ensuing problems far outweigh what it would have taken to prevent the conflict/blow-up/litigation in the first place.&lt;/p&gt;
